Legality in Canada
This is a super important point, so listen up! Online gambling is legal in Canada, but it’s regulated at the provincial level. This means that each province and territory has its own rules and regulations regarding online casinos. Some provinces have their own licensed online casinos (like PlayNow in British Columbia), while others allow access to offshore online casinos that are licensed and regulated in other jurisdictions. Always make sure you’re playing at a reputable and licensed online casino to ensure fair play and the safety of your personal and financial information. Check the casino’s licensing information – it should be clearly displayed on their website.
Choosing a Reputable Online Casino
With so many options out there, how do you choose a safe and trustworthy online casino? Here’s what to look for:
- Licensing: As mentioned, this is crucial. Look for licenses from reputable regulatory b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C).
- Security: The casino should use secure encryption technology (like SSL) to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ock symbol in your browser’s address bar.
- Game Variety: Does the casino offer a good selection of games that you enjoy?
- Software Providers: Reputable online casinos partner with well-known software providers like Microgaming, NetEnt, and Playtech. These providers ensure fair games and random number generators (RNGs).
- Payment Options: Does the casino offer convenient and secure payment methods that you trust, such as cred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al or Skrill), or bank transfers?
- Customer Support: Check for responsive and helpful customer support, ideally available 24/7 via live chat, email, or phone.
- Reviews and Reputation: Do some research! Read reviews from other players to get an idea of their experiences with the casino. Be wary of casinos with a lot of negative feedback.

Responsible Gambling: Your Safety Net
This is arguably the most important section. Online gambling should be a fun and entertaining activity, but it’s crucial to gamble responsibly to avoid potential problems. Here’s how:
- Set a Budget: Decide how much money you’re willing to spend and stick to it. Never chase your losses.
- Set Time Limits: Decide how long you will play for each session.
- Know Your Limits: Don’t gamble when you’re feeling stressed, upset, or under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
- Use Self-Exclusion Tools: If you feel you’re developing a gambling problem, many casinos offer self-exclusion options, allowing you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from accessing their services.
- Seek Help If Needed: If you’re struggling with problem gambling, don’t hesitate to seek help from organizations like the Responsible Gambling Council or the Problem Gambling Helpline. They offer confidential support and resources.
Understanding Casino Games
Online casinos offer a vast array of games. Here’s a quick overview of some popular choices:
- Slots: These are the most popular games, offering a wide variety of themes, paylines, and bonus features. They’re easy to learn and offer the potential for big wins.
- Blackjack: A classic card game where you try to beat the dealer by getting a hand as close to 21 as possible without going over.
- Roulette: A game of chance where you b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el.
- Poker: Several variations of poker are available, including Texas Hold’em and Omaha.
- Baccarat: A simple card game where you bet on the player, the banker, or a tie.
- Live Dealer Games: These games stream a real dealer in real-time, offering a more immersive and social experience.
